  • Biocompatible polymer and filter for selectively eliminating leucocytes using the same
    申请人:Kuno Susumu
    公开号:US20060073467A1
    公开(公告)日:2006-04-06
    It is intended to provide a polymer which is scarcely eluted, has a high biocompatibility and is useful in a filter for selectively eliminating leucocytes. It is also intended to provide a filter for selectively eliminating leucocytes, a filtration apparatus for selectively eliminating leucocytes and a system for selectively eliminating leucocytes, each having the above-described polymer. The above objects can be achieved by providing a polymer which comprises from 8% by mol to 45% by mol of a unit originating in a polymerizable monomer having a polyalkylene oxide chain, from 30% by mol to 90% by mol of a unit originating in a polymerizable monomer having a hydrophobic group, and from 2% by mol to 50% by mol of a unit originating in polymerizable monomer having a hydroxyl group.
    本发明旨在提供一种几乎不被洗脱、具有高生物相容性并且适用于选择性消除白细胞的过滤器的聚合物。还旨在提供一种用于选择性消除白细胞的过滤器、一种用于选择性消除白细胞的过滤装置和一种用于选择性消除白细胞的系统,每种都具有上述聚合物。通过提供一种聚合物,其中包括8%摩尔到45%摩尔的起源于具有聚烯烃氧化物链的可聚合单体的单元,30%摩尔到90%摩尔的起源于具有疏水基团的可聚合单体的单元,以及2%摩尔到50%摩尔的起源于具有羟基的可聚合单体的单元,可以实现上述目标。

  • Electrolytic membrane for use as a solid polymer electrolyte in a rechargeable battery and process for its photo-crosslinking on a cathodic collector
    申请人:ENIRICERCHE S.p.A.
    公开号:EP0774795A2
    公开(公告)日:1997-05-21
    Electrolytic membrane for light rechargeable batteries essentially consisting of: 1) polymer deriving from the photopolymerization of a mixture essentially consisting of a vinyl ether having the general formula (I) R-[-O-CH2CH2-]n-O-CH=CH2, and a divinyl ether having the general formula (II) CH2=CH-[-O-CH2-CH2-]m-O-CH=CH2, in a quantity of between 15 and 60% by weight; 2) plasticizer in a quantity of between 35 and 75% by weight; 3) Lithium salt in a quantity of between 5 and 20% by weight; 4) photopolymerization initiator in such a quantity as to photopolymerize (I) and (II); 5) zeolite in a quantity of between 3 and 30% by weight; the percentage sum of components (1) to (5) being equal to 100.
    用于轻型充电电池的电解膜主要由以下部分组成: 1) 主要由通式为(I)R-[-O-CH2CH2-]n-O-CH=CH2 的乙烯基醚和通式为(II)CH2=CH-[-O-CH2-CH2-]m-O-CH=CH2 的二乙烯基醚组成的混合物光聚合而成的聚合物,其重量百分比在 15%至 60%之间; 2) 增塑剂,重量百分比为 35%至 75%; 3) 锂盐,按重量计,含量在 5%至 20%之间; 4) 光聚合引发剂,用量为使(I)和(II)发生光聚合反应; 5) 沸石,重量百分比为 3%至 30%; 成分(1)至(5)的百分比总和等于 100。
